Confidence Intervals for the Mean (Small Samples)

An experimental egg farm is raising chickens to produce low cholesterol eggs. A lab tested 16 randomly selected eggs and found that the mean amount of cholesterol was X(with line above the X) = 190 mg. The sample standard deviation was found to be s = 18.0 mg on this group. Assume that the population is normally distributed.

a. Find the margin of error for a 95% confidence interval. Round your answer to the nearest tenths =

b.Find a 95% confidence interval for the mean u cholesterol content for all experimental eggs. Assume that the population is normally distributed =
